Transaction 2bd18d9c81d924081d65143190f57ebcdcb4b0fc3e20ced71f09e5105684f7dd

3 Input
2 Outputs
  • 2bd18d9c81d924081d65143190f57ebcdcb4b0fc3e20ced71f09e5105684f7dd:0
  • value  104000000
    address  35NDWYhL6FvtWNjJcDqrR6Z6yzcP4AfRHn
  • 2bd18d9c81d924081d65143190f57ebcdcb4b0fc3e20ced71f09e5105684f7dd:1
  • value  42912
    address  3HsxGPSPzKuuF5iveSZsVZuhPb7mZFqi5J